User Adoption Research: Quick Tips from my Research

Small steps/quick wins win; allow failures to drive learning; develop trust within your organization to drive success

Block (2008) reminds the reader that small steps allow the group to remain in a pattern of learn, experiment, learn again, which is a requirement for communal transformation (p. 74).  Leaders must reframe the concept of failing to the concept of learning, according to Heath and Heath (2010); the momentum changes, the frustration is lessened, and challenges that deliver insights are now viewed as optimistic (p. 169).  Trust and confidence in the ability of the leadership to design, implement, and manage transparent and honest change within the organization is imperative for change success (Rosenbaum et al., 2017, p. 82).  - SJG

Taken from "How Diffusion of Innovations, Change Management, and Adult Learner User Adoption Theories Impact Customer Relationship Management (CRM) Adoption and Usage in Nonprofit Organizations" - to be submitted in defense of the PhD requirements for Shannon J. Gregg

Advice from an Expert

Q:  I got a notice that the Microsoft Edge Legacy browser was no longer being supported by Salesforce.  So, what's the best browser for Salesforce, for once and for all?

A:  The simple answer is Google Chrome for desktops or laptops, and the Salesforce mobile app for tablet or phone.  For more details on other browsers and specifics on touch-enabled laptops, here's a great help document.  - LF
